Output 8522d3befea92ad4e1cc5b07f2bfb77cefa17906353d38d79b0a2e9528130ae2:16

value
101514
script pubkey
OP_0 OP_PUSHBYTES_20 21fb784d82a72ce4ea8c52f4a5a1fa6a93322f6a
address
bc1qy8ahsnvz5ukwf65v2t62tg06d2fnytm2gvdg0f
transaction
8522d3befea92ad4e1cc5b07f2bfb77cefa17906353d38d79b0a2e9528130ae2
confirmations
14363
spent
true